Abstract
Three cases of pregnancy are reported in patients with partial epilepsy (2 cryptogenetic, 1 cortical dysplasia), all of them following new AEDs monotherapy treatment. No major seizures occurred but one simple partial seizure during the first three months for the patient with cortical dysplasia. No teratogenic effect of the new AEDs was shown for the newborns.
